Box Score WILMINGTON, DE- Led by three goals from freshman Terell Williams, the Chowan University men's soccer team used a strong second half to earn a commanding 6-2 win over Goldey-Beacom on Saturday afternoon. The Hawks improve to 1-1 with the victory while the Lightning start their season 0-1.
After battling to a 1-1 draw in the first half, the Hawks pulled away in the first 16 minutes of the second half to gain a 4-1 advantage they never relinquished. Williamson scored two of his three goals during the spurt.
The Lightning trimmed the margin to 4-2 in the 62nd minute when freshman forward Fernando Sanchez tallied the first goal of his college career off an assist from freshman midfielder Manuel Berto.
However, Williamson struck again for his third goal just 56 seconds later to increase the advantage to 5-2. With 22:13 remaining, freshman midfielder
Christian Funes upped the Hawks' lead to 6-2 after a restart pass from freshman midfielder
Francisco Ferrus.
Making the first start of his college career, freshman goalkeeper Marcus Arrvidsson made two saves for the Lightning.
Junior goalkeeper
Marco Lujan and sophomore goalkeeper
Carlos Ramirez each posted two saves for the Hawks. The Lightning out-shot Chowan by a 15-10 margin, including a 10-3 edge in the first half, but the second half momentum carried the Hawks to the 6-2 win.
Jordan Radisavljevic chipped in two goals in the win for the Hawks while Funes had four assists for the Blue and White.
